Overview:

Unacast is seeking a strategic and experienced Director, Data Acquisition & Partnerships to lead our efforts in acquiring and managing our location data supply sources and vendor relationships.  This position will play a pivotal role in shaping our data strategy and ensuring the availability of high-quality location data assets to drive our product objectives and serve the needs of our clients.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Strategy: Develop and execute a comprehensive data acquisition strategy aligned with Unacast goals and market demands, balancing volume (quantity and geographic coverage), Unacast product alignment, quality, and cost effectiveness. 
  • Vendor Management:  Build and maintain strong relationships with data vendors, negotiate contracts, and manage performance to ensure quality, timeliness, and cost-effectiveness. Develop and monitor KPIs to evaluate vendor performance.
  • Data Partnerships: Proactively research to identify new partnerships with strategic data providers, ensuring alignment with our data needs and compliance with regulatory requirements.
  • Data Quality Assurance: Partner with our Data Analytics team to implement robust processes for evaluating data providers to ensure the quality, reliability, and relevance of acquired data. 
  • Operational Efficiency: Collaborate internally to optimize processes related to data acquisition, vendor onboarding, and performance management to enhance operational efficiency. 
  • Compliance and Risk Management:  Partner with Chief Privacy Officer to ensure adherence to data privacy regulations and industry standards.  Research and implement best practices in data acquisition and vendor management.
  • Collaboration: Collaborate cross-functionally with key stakeholders to support product development and related data needs; develop criteria to evaluate new potential data vendors; and implement data-driven decision-making parameters to manage vendors.

 

Skills & Experience:

  • Proven experience (10+ years) in a leadership role overseeing data acquisition and vendor management.
  • Deep understanding of data markets, trends, data nuances, technologies, and regulatory environments relevant to the location intelligence industry.
  • Excellent communication and negotiation skills, with the ability to build consensus and influence stakeholders at all levels.  
  • Strong relationship building skills, both internally and externally.  
  • Demonstrated ability to develop and execute strategic initiatives that drive business growth through data acquisition and management.
  • Strong analytical and problem-solving skills, with a solid understanding of data quality standards and metrics.
